HOW DO WE ACCOMPLISH THIS WITH STAGE 2?

  • Extensive research and development has allowed us to make more power with this platform.  Not only are we making more power but we are also revising ECU tables to make the bike safer and more reliable for those long trips where having issues isn’t an option.
  • Stage 1 was derestricting the K1600. Stage 2 is optimized for best performance at all times without sacrificing reliability or rideability. We left no stone unturned in our Stage 2 development and spent hours, days, and months to perfect Stage 2 with our R&D.
  • The air/fuel ratio has been carefully measured in testing with the other changes we’ve made optimizes your K1600 for peak performance and reliability.
  • The K1600 has multiple ignition maps (timing maps).  The point to this is to ensure your bike runs at peak performance and reliablity, even when bad fuel is present. Bad fuel would be defined as a fuel that has lower than advertised octane, old fuel that’s been sitting in the bike that has now going bad, or a forgetful user that just pumped incorrect octane fuel at the gas station. With our extensive R&D process we’ve been able to optimize each ignition map to not only add more power to your K1600, but also make sure that if bad fuel is present, the motorcycle will still maintain it’s reliability.
  • In an effort to cool the engine down more, we have lowered the temperature in which the radiator fans come on. This keeps your bike cooler and more consistent with power.
  • Torque limit tables in dynamic mode have all been raised to give you maximum performance.
  • We changed the EGT (exhaust gas temperatures) tables for maximum performance. Expect large increases in low-end and mid-range throttle response through 100% direct throttle opening in dynamic mode.
  • After testing, we have mapping available for aftermarket exhaust systems. We support the stock system, of course, as well as Remus and Akrapovic Systems.

WHY IS THIS THE BEST UPGRADE YOU CAN BUY?

The biggest complaints from owners revolved around the pitiful throttle response and of course, the terribly restrictive top speed limiter. First we baselined the motorcycle in 100% stock ECU form, the motorcycle we used for testing has around 8,000 miles and was well broken in. In stock configuration we found all the talk of poor throttle was spot on. The power also flattened out and the motor was very rich and under-timed.

With or without custom mapping, we all know the BMW K1600 is a wonderful bike that’s amazing for touring! We also know it isn’t perfect. Issues that we’ve verified ourselves and what customers have reported include the following:

  • Bad throttle response
  • Top speed limiter
  • Under-timed engine that may feel lazy when power is needed
  • Mapping only good for one kind of fuel

WHAT DID WE DO ABOUT THIS?

After months of testing we have had successfully calibrated our in-house test bike. This calibration will work for all B/GA/GT/GTL bikes as the ECU’s are the same with minor difference between them.  We have also tested our mapping on the road while logging all parameters of the bike to ensure reliability and consistency.  So what did we change?

  • Improved throttle response! Throttle tables maximized to provide a snappier and more responsive throttle.
  • Top speed limiter removed. We tested our own K1600 all the way to 170 MPH on our in-house dyno (NOT EVER RECOMMENDED ON THE ROAD).
  • HP gains of +18HP with a climbing HP curve from 5000RPM to redline – we did this by modifying the throttle which is stuck at a 75% max opening in factory configuration; with light changes to ignition timing and torque, along with other tables that have proven to work great in the BMW tuning world. (17+ model power estimates)
  • Ignition advanced with safety in mind – there are multiple ignition maps for the K1600. We have altered these maps to give you maximum power. We also have safety built in. If your bike detects a lower octane fuel or fuel that may be bad out of the pump, our mapping will pull power out of the bike until it gets quality fuel.
  • With our handheld tuner we can configure and maximize mapping for any kind of fuel with the ability to go back to your stock mapping if you need to go to the dealer for servicing or warranty issues.

THE BRENTUNING MOTO HANDHELD TUNER

WHAT IS A HANDHELD TUNER AND WHAT ARE THE BENEFITS OF HAVING ONE?

Thoroughly tested by our own engineers, not just for its function but also durability.  We purposefully dropped this thing about 100 times just to make sure if you accidentally dropped it, it would still be a usable device.

So why buy it when you can just send in your ECU for flashing and spend less? Let’s see the breakdown.

NO DOWNTIME – No need to send in your ECU or remove it from your bike at all.  You order the handheld, it get’s delivered to you, you flash your bike.  You never miss a day of riding and no effort removing the ECU.

STORE MULTIPLE MAPS – When you send in your ECU, you only get one map.  You might be thinking, “why would I need more than one map?”.  Storing multiple maps means you’re able to flash for different fuels.  If you’re a serious track competitor, we can work with you to get you different mapping for different tracks.  If, for example, you’re add an exhaust to your stock bike, we can email you a file that takes the new exhaust into account with the changes you need to optimize your bike’s new modifications.

GO BACK TO STOCK ANYTIME – Not only can you store multiple race maps, you can also flash the original, stock file back into the bike at any time and for any reason.

    Concerns
    OK, so to address the elephant in the room. Ya, I am a little concerned about how modifying the ECU could impact the warranty. Right wrong or indifferent here’s my view. These engines are pretty solid. The tuning isn’t doing anything crazy. In fact, it is VERY conservative. The tuning didn’t do anything more than what came stock on the K1600 just a few years ago. Now, I suppose if you asked for more, they could do it. But then I would agree you are risking breaking something. But what kind of risk is there if you aren’t doing anything more than what the manufacturer was doing before they had to comply with emission regulations? Could it all go to Hell in a handbasket? I suppose, but I rode the stink out of my last K with no issues and I have logged 15K on this bike. And I think that’s pretty much the norm for most owners. The icing on the cake is that, from what I understand, the changes made are invisible to BMW. One other downside; if the shop hooks her up to the BMW mothership and reflashes the ECU, well your tuning is erased and you will have to ship it back to Bren Tuning to be redone. They will, as you would expect, cut you a break on pricing to get it redone. But, it’s not free and you are without your bike (again) while the reprogramming happens. So, best thing you can do is tell the shop NOT to re-flash you bike. Tell them you like the way it rides and don’t want any updates. They should do as you asked.
